            These 
              pictures are an update on the Ahearne bike I have posted in Current 
              Classics. This is my daily commuter for getting to work. It is a 
              great rider! I asked Joseph to paint it in a color which would evoke 
              Hawaii and springtime, to help overcome the gray winter blahs. These 
              were taken at one of my favorite places, the Point White pier on 
              the west side of the island where I live.  
            The 
              parts include the following:  
              Frame, stem and fork custom made by Joseph Ahearne  
              Honjo fenders (painted to match!)  
              Schmidt dynohub on the front, with E6 light  
              Velocity Synergy rims  
              White Industries rear hub  
              Chris King headset  
              Brooks B-17 saddle  
              Harris custom cassette 13-30  
              Shimano cantilever brakes 
              Sugino 
              XD crank 26-36-46  
              Shimano XTR rear derailleur, XT front Shimano 9 speed bar-end shifters 
               
              Nitto Noodle bars  
              Old Modolo brake handles- I used these on my last bike for 20 years; 
              they are on here for aesthetic and nostalgic reasons  
              Nitto mini rack
